Turkmenistan requires a visa for all international visitors, including citizens of the United States, United Kingdom, Canada, and Australia, with no visa-free entry available for tourism.[9][5][6] Travelers must obtain a Letter of Invitation (LOI) certified by the State Migration Service of Turkmenistan, typically arranged through a licensed tour agency for tourist visas, before applying at an embassy/consulate or airport.[4][1][2] Visa on arrival is available at Ashgabat International Airport and select land borders (e.g., with Uzbekistan, Iran), but requires the original...

Cost of Living Index
Very expensive with CPI: 102.3 (NYC=100). Groceries index: 112.0, rent: 22.9, restaurant prices: 89.8.
Housing Market
Very expensive with property price to income ratio: 26.0 years. Rent index: 22.9 offers some affordability.
Average Income Levels
Low purchasing power index: 18.5. GDP per capita: ~$7919 USD in 2024.
Tax System
Personal income tax: 10% flat rate. VAT: 15%, corporate tax: 8-20%. Limited transparency and regional variations due to state control.
Business Environment
Highly challenging with heavy bureaucracy, state dominance in hydrocarbons, and strict exchange controls. No recent World Bank Doing Business rank; high regulatory burden.
Social Security
Basic state healthcare and pension systems exist, but quality is low with limited coverage. Unemployment benefits minimal amid poverty and shortages.
Turkmenistan features a predominantly arid continental climate dominated by the vast Karakum Desert, classified primarily as cold semi-arid (BSk) and cold desert (BWk) under Köppen system. Summers are intensely hot with averages of 27-29°C and peaks near 50°C, while winters remain mild at 8-9°C with occasional frosts to -15°C or lower in northern areas.

Turkmenistan is governed as a presidential republic under authoritarian rule, with President Serdar Berdimuhamedow serving as both head of state and head of government since 2022. The country operates a unicameral legislature (Mejlis) with 125 seats, though real political power is concentrated in the presidency and the People's Council chaired by former President Gurbanguly Berdimuhamedow. Turkmenistan is considered to have one of the world's most restrictive political systems, with limited press freedom and non-democratic electoral processes.
